In our part of the world cameras, especially the rear ones are covered with ice, salt, water, and who knows what from about November to April, rendering them effectively useless. Learn to use your mirrors, they are much more reliable. Wiping cameras off at this time of year is a cure for maybe 10 minutes. I'd rather not be jumping out of the car every time I need to see what's behind me. (This is not a Tesla-specific problem. it is, however, one of the things that makes me laugh at the idea of a vision only FSD system.)
My previous car (an Audi A4 all road) had a small nozzle that sprayed the rear camera when you cleared the rear window. Living in Canada with all the winter crap, this was a real life saver.
